AI Integration in Hardware and Software Development
The synergy between hardware and software development is critical for effective AI implementation. Specialized AI chips, or neural processing units (NPUs), are becoming standard components in modern gadgets, providing dedicated computing power for AI tasks directly on the device. This hardware foundation supports complex software frameworks that enable machine learning models to run efficiently. The ongoing development in both areas allows for faster processing, improved energy efficiency, and the execution of more sophisticated AI applications without relying solely on cloud connectivity.

Advanced Processing and Display Technologies
AI significantly contributes to advancements in processing capabilities and display technologies. Modern processors, augmented by AI, can handle vast amounts of data more efficiently, leading to quicker response times and enhanced performance in high-demand applications like gaming or video editing. Furthermore, AI algorithms are utilized to optimize visual output on displays, adjusting colors, contrast, and brightness in real-time to provide a superior viewing experience. This continuous development in processing and displays ensures that consumer gadgets deliver increasingly immersive and high-quality digital experiences.
